Yes, You Can Collect Social Security from an Ex-Spouse: Here’s How

WebApr 12, 2024 · Yes, you can. However, an ex-spouse’s benefits differ from a current spouse’s. You may qualify for benefits based on your ex-spouse’s income history if: You are an ex-spouse of a worker eligible for Social Security disability or retirement benefits You are not remarried and You are 62 years old and older Other conditions apply, however.
